%0 Journal Article %T MCI Regulations on Graduate Medical Education, 2012- Are we ready for paradigm shift? %A Varsha Patel %A Pankaj R Patel %J NHL Journal of Medical Sciences %D 2012 %I SMT NHL Municipal Medical College %X Medical college equips medical students with the scientific background and technical skills they need for practice. But it is equally important for the new graduates to both understand and commit to high personal and professional values. Globally, there is an increasing concern among society about doctors¡® adequacy of the scientific education, clinical skills, interactions with patients and commitment to improving healthcare and providing leadership. India is no exception with frequent hue and cry expressed about proficiency of our doctors. Obviously a need has been felt since long for overhauling our medical education to make it more relevant to the role of future graduates as ¨DGood Doctors¡¬. %K MCI %K doctors %K medical students %U http://www.nhlmmc.edu.in/document/volume1.issue1/5-6.pdf
